Our Brokerage Approach: How it Works.

At Viking, our team believes in a full business brokerage service approach. This begins with your initial consultation and free business valuation where we create an estimate of your business’s value.

Then we list and market your business to generate interest and carefully screen the prospective buyers who contact us. All of this is done confidentiality, without mentioning the name of your business or other sensitive details.

Qualified prospective buyers then sign an NDA agreement and are allowed access to additional information with your approval. Should the buyer request a meeting with you, we assist you before and during the meeting.

Once an offer letter is received, our intermediary explains the various terms of the offer and counsels you about accepting, rejecting, or issuing a counter-offer.

Once an accepted offer is in place, we assist you throughout the due diligence phase and recommend any outside professional assistance that you may need (such as accountants or lawyers) outside of our brokerage.

Finally, when due diligence is complete, it is time for closing, where all of the final papers are signed and the funds are transferred. At this point you’ve successfully sold your business. Viking will continue to stay involved and assist with any post-closing actions.

Relationships With Thousands of Qualified Buyers

Most businesses that sell in the $1mm to $10mm range are bought by either financial buyers or individuals who plan to own and operate the business themselves. At Viking, we have built relationships with thousands of prospective individual buyers who are actively seeking the right business opportunity. One of the many benefits of working with us as your business broker is your immediate access to the large and highly-qualified buyer pool we have been building since 1996. When we list a new business, we draw attention from this existing buyer pool even before we begin marketing to buyers outside of our network.
